Etymology

[edit]

Borrowed from Classical Persian دلیری (dilērī), apparently analyzable as a derivative of दिल (dil, heart); if so, then distantly cognate with English courage.

Pronunciation

[edit]
  • (Delhi) IPA(key): /d̪ɪ.leː.ɾiː/

Noun

[edit]

दिलेरी (dilerīf (Urdu spelling دلیری)

  1. boldness, bravery, valour
    Synonyms: हिम्मत (himmat), बहादुरी (bahādurī)
